Just upgraded to Plesk 11.5.30 and found out that sending SMTP emails with php pear aren't working anymore with following error message:

mod_fcgid: stderr: PHP Fatal error: require_once(): 
Failed opening required 'Mail.php' 
(include_path='.:/usr/share/pear') 
in /var/www/vhosts/mydomain.com/httpdocs/check.php on line 4 

I know in the new Plesk 11.5 they changed the structure of all vhosts, but the strange thing is that require_once('System.php') placed into the same directory and file is working correctly with no errors and is returning bool(true).

Any hints where I could have a look with this mod_fcgid error when

require_once('System.php')

is working but

require_once('Mail.php')

isn't working?
